Led Zeppelin digital box set available for pre-order exclusively on Apple’s iTunes Store
Tuesday, October 23, 2007 - 08:54 AM EST

Apple iTunesApple today announced that a special digital box set containing Led Zeppelin’s entire discography, “The Complete Led Zeppelin,” is now available for pre-order exclusively on the iTunes Store. “The Complete Led Zeppelin” is a 165-track collection of all 13 of the legendary group’s albums, including the new career-spanning “Mothership” retrospective, for only $99.

“We’re excited to offer Led Zeppelin’s entire catalog as a special digital box set with this pre-order,” said Eddy Cue, Apple’s vice president of iTunes, in the press release. “Now you can get all of the band’s albums with one click for an incredible $99.”

“Led Zeppelin is a band that made albums; each one legendary from start to finish," said David Dorn, senior vice president of e-Commerce for Rhino Entertainment, in the press release. “We’re excited to offer this incredible digital boxed set on iTunes, which represents one of the greatest bodies of music ever recorded and should be owned by every rock music fan.”

Led Zeppelin’s “Mothership,” a 24-track collection of the group’s best-known songs, hand-picked by Robert Plant, Jimmy Page and John Paul Jones, is also available today for pre-order. Touching on every studio album, the collection contains defining songs including “Whole Lotta Love,” “Rock and Roll” and “Kashmir.” In addition to “The Complete Led Zeppelin” and “Mothership,” Led Zeppelin’s entire catalog of songs and albums will also be available for individual purchase and download beginning November 13.

Fans who pre-order “The Complete Led Zeppelin” or “Mothership” will be automatically entered to win the chance to see the band’s reunion performance at London’s O2 Arena on November 26 as part of the Ahmet Ertegun Tribute. The winners will receive two tickets to the show, round-trip airfare and hotel accommodations.*

Apple's iTunes Store is the world’s most popular online music, TV and movie store and has become the number three music retailer in the US, surpassing both Amazon and Target. The iTunes Store features the world’s largest catalog with over six million songs, 550 television shows and over 500 movies and has sold over three billion songs, 100 million TV shows and over two million movies.
